Waste of Money July 5, 2004 8 out of 10 found this review helpful
This DVD sucks. It has 25 mins of footage on it, and most of that is taken up by 2 music videos, which come on Disasterpieces anyway. All up, there is about 15 spoken words from the band members, they all introduce themselves by saying their name, number and instrument, followed by about 30 secs of footage of that person on stage. Interviews-wise, there are 3 questions asked, and all are answered with 1 sentence each.A HUGE waste of money
